Investing Activities
Investing activities include transactions involving the acquisition or disposal of long-term assets and investments, which are reflected in the cash flow statement.
Purchase of Land
An accounting transaction involving the acquisition of land, classified as a non-current asset on the balance sheet.
Significant Noncash
Transactions or activities that have a major impact on a company's financial position but do not involve a direct exchange of cash.
Preferred Shares
A class of stock that provides owners with a fixed dividend ahead of the company's common shares and with priority over common shares in asset liquidation.
